On Fri, 04 Dec 2009 13:20:11 +1100, Benjamin Herrenschmidt wrote: > On Mon, 2009-11-30 at 15:47 -0800, Darrick J. Wong wrote: > > In commit 0512a9a8e277a9de2820211eef964473b714ae65, we unilaterally zero the > > "pwm invert" bit in the fan behavior configuration register. On my PowerBook > > G4, this results in the fans going to full speed at low temperature and > > shutting off at high temperature because the pwm invert bit is supposed to be > > set. > > > > Therefore, record the pwm invert bit at driver load time, and write the bit > > into the fan behavior control register. This restores correct behavior on my > > PBG4 and should work around the bit being set to the wrong value after > > suspend/resume (which is what the original patch was trying to fix). It also > > fixes a minor omission where the pwm invert bit correction is NOT performed > > when switching into automatic mode. > > Thanks, I'll apply.
This is a pretty serious bug, please make sure to send the fix to the stable team for kernels 2.6.31 and 2.6.32.
